On 06/06/2021 at 08:11, LarrysRightFoot said:

Just had a look and the website doesn’t have that little padlock in the address bar - does that not mean it’s dodgy? 

It's not using HTTPS, meaning a third party can potentially view packets being sent over this website because it's unencrypted or do 'man in the middle' attacks which means you send them money and the money never gets to them, it goes to the person acting maliciously. If you're buying things online then always look for the padlock. Even then it can be spoofed. Be very careful buying things which are 'dodgy' in any way, for example counterfeit football strips, especially if they're not based in the UK.
